How are the particles arranged in a liquid?
Back
Particles are close together but can move past each other, allowing liquids to flow and take the shape of their container.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
How is a gas defined?
Back
A gas has no fixed shape and no fixed volume.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What describes a solid?
Back
A solid has a fixed shape and a definite volume.
